The SRH1540 is not inferior to the SRH1840 both are the new flagships from Shure, however the 1540 is the 'closed' model and the 1840 is the 'open' model.
For the €500 you spend, you do get a pearl of headphones that you can enjoy for years to come. Do you use it for the phone? Then a mobile amplifier/DAC is highly recommended, and Tidal too, because with these headphones you will hear the difference between lossless and 320Kb/s (the maximum of Spotify).
Most importantly, it is a balanced pair of headphones. A miss for some, especially people who want more of a booming bass than a musical bass.
Although this model does not have active noise canceling, you don't need it, as soon as the music plays, there is no longer a world around you.

The Shure SRH 1540 fully meets my expectations. I've been impressed with my Shure SE 530 in-ear earphones for years and, as earphones don't feel so comfortable after a while, I was looking for a pair of headphones of comparable quality. The SRH 1540 sounds even better: detailed and balanced. The music sounds as it should be, aggressive music sounds aggressive, relaxing music sounds relaxing and sultry music sounds sultry. It is a bit of a shame to simply connect this Shure to, for example, an iPhone. Then he doesn't come into his own. That's why I use the AudioQuest DragonFly Red DAC/headphone amplifier in combination with the iPhone. Then enjoy!
